    UPESEAT Syllabus 2026 for BTech

    The UPES entrance exam syllabus for BTech is designed to test candidates' knowledge in subjects such as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ics. Here's a subject-wise breakdown:

    UPESEAT Syllabus 2026 for Physics

    The UPES entrance exam syllabus for Physics includes both fundamental and advanced topics. The key areas are cited below:

    • Units and Vectors

    • Kinematics and Dynamics

    • Centre of mass

    • Friction

    • Rotary motion

    • Elasticity and Surface Tension

    • Expansion and Thermodynamics

    • Thermal radiation

    • Sound

    • Optics (Geo and Physical)

    • Magnetism

    • Electrostatics and Current Electricity

    • Atomic and Nuclear Physics

    • Semi-Conductors

    UPESEAT Syllabus 2026 for Chemistry

    The syllabus for the UPES entrance exam in Chemistry focuses on the following areas:

    • Atomic structure and Chemical bonding

    • Gaseous state

    • Chemical Equilibrium & Kinetics

    • Electrochemistry and Solution

    • Periodic Classification of Elements

    • Alkyl Halides, Alcohol & Ethers

    • Hydrocarbons

    • Aldehydes and Ketones, Carboxylic Acids

    • Nitrogen Compounds

    • Alkali & Alkaline Earth Metals, Hydrogen & its compound, Noble gases

    • Nuclear Chemistry

    UPESEAT Syllabus 2026 for Mathematics

    Mathematics in the UPES entrance exam 2026 syllabus includes:

    • Algebra

    • Equations

    • Number System

    • Trigonometry

    • Vector Algebra

    • Mensuration

    • Venn Diagram

    • Probability

    • Mathematical modelling

    • Coordinate Geometry

    • Calculus

    English Language Syllabus for UPESEAT 2026

    The UPES entrance exam syllabus 2026 also tests candidates on basic English proficiency, which includes:

    • Reading Comprehension

    • Tenses & Gerunds

    • Articles & Preposition

    • Speech

    • Sentence Correction

    • Synonyms & Antonyms

    • Vocabulary

    • Spelling

    • Phrases & Idioms

    • Sequencing

    UPESEAT Exam Pattern 2026

    UPES has released the UPESEAT 2026 exam pattern on the official website, upes.ac.in. The UPESEAT exam pattern 2026 includes details on the mode, exam duration, number of sections, number and type of questions, etc. According to the UPESEAT exam pattern, there will be 125 multiple-choice questions of 1 mark each.
